Artificial intelligence is redefining how organizations capture, organize, and surface knowledge. Mindbreeze’s platform leverages large‑language models, semantic indexing, and real‑time analytics to deliver context‑aware results that reduce time‑to‑insight. By integrating generative AI capabilities, the company enables users to ask natural‑language questions and receive concise, source‑cited answers, a functionality that differentiates it from legacy enterprise search tools. This technological edge aligns with a broader industry shift toward unified knowledge graphs and automated content classification, driving higher adoption rates across regulated and knowledge‑intensive sectors.
